Yet, he feels that there is no alternative to holding on to his divine feet and praying to him to forbear his false love.<\/p>\n<p>Let us go through the pAsuram and its meanings:<\/p>\n<p><em>ARiya anbil adiyAr tham ArvaththAl<\/em><br \/>\n<em> kURiya kuRRamAk koLLal nI thERi<\/em><br \/>\n<em> nediyOy adi adaidhaRkanRE Iraindhu<\/em><br \/>\n<em> mudiyAn padaiththa muraN<\/em><\/p>\n<h3><strong>Word by Word Meanings<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p>ARiya anbu il \u2013 without the bhakthi which had simmered after reaching a crescendo<br \/>\nadiyAr \u2013 followers<br \/>\ntham ArvaththAl \u2013 with their friendliness<br \/>\nkURiya \u2013 the words spoken<br \/>\nnI kuRRamAk koLLal \u2013 you should not mistake<br \/>\nIr aindhu mudiyAn\u00a0 &#8211; the ten headed rAvaNan<br \/>\npadaiththa \u2013 carried out<br \/>\nmuraN \u2013 enmity<br \/>\nthERi \u2013 after clarifying<br \/>\nnediyOy adi \u2013 the divine feet of <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/sriman-narayanan\/\">emperumAn<\/a><br \/>\nadaidhaRku anRE \u2013 did it not become a reason for attaining!<\/p>\n<h3><strong>vyAkyAnam<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p><strong>ARiya anbil adiyAr<\/strong> \u2013 followers who do not have the bhakthi (devotion) which had simmered. just as the sea becomes calm after being turbulent. <em>ARiya anbu<\/em> is showing affection in such a way that the person does not worry about himself but only wonders as to what will happen to <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/sriman-narayanan\/\">emperumAn<\/a>. Showing affection (devotion) towards emperumAn is the svarUpam (basic nature) of <a href=\"https:\/\/granthams.koyil.org\/2013\/03\/06\/thathva-thrayam-chith-who-am-i\/\">AthmA<\/a>; hence not showing affection towards him is equivalent to displaying enmity towards him.<\/p>\n<p><strong>tham ArvaththAl kURiya kuRRamAk koLLal<\/strong> \u2013 whatever the devotees said out of their affection should not be considered as fault. Those words have been spoken by your followers so that they can sustain their affection towards you (if they had not spoken those words, they would have died perhaps). <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/poigai-azhwar\/\">AzhwAr<\/a> says that even such words spoken so affectionately about <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/sriman-narayanan\/\">emperumAn<\/a> stand nowhere in comparison to the love shown by yaSOdhA.<\/p>\n<p><strong>kuRRamAK koLLal<\/strong> \u2013 you should not consider such words as a fault (<a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/poigai-azhwar\/\">AzhwAr<\/a> says that emperumAn should forbear these words as the followers did not say them consciously and would not have sustained themselves had they not stated such words). <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/thirumazhisai-azhwar\/\">thirumazhisai AzhwAr<\/a> says in thiruchchandha viruththam 111 \u201c<em>seydha kuRRam naRRamAgavE koL<\/em>\u201d (you should consider the fault as a good deed). AzhwAr says that by saying that you should not consider them as fault, he is not saying that he has not committed any fault. It is just that he is praying that he should not consider them as faults. Once <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/sriman-narayanan\/\">emperumAn<\/a> says that he has forgiven his follower\u2019s faults, the faults do not remain as faults anymore and become good deeds.<\/p>\n<p>How is it possible to tell emperumAn not to consider as faults when faults have been committed?&#8230;.<\/p>\n<p><strong>thERi nediyOy adi adaidhaRkanRE Iraindhu mudiyAn padaiththa muraN<\/strong> \u2013 the enmity that rAvaNan had towards emperumAn, over a period of time, became the reason for SiSupAlan to reach emperumAn\u2019s divine feet! If we consider the meaning for <em>thErI<\/em> as being happy, it could be construed that <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/poigai-azhwar\/\">AzhwAr<\/a> is requesting emperumAn not to consider as faults whatever he did, out of happiness. If we consider the meaning for <em>thERi<\/em> as clarity, (after rAvaNan was reborn as SiSupAlan), in his last days when krishNa stood in front of him with his divine chakram (disc), SiSupAlan got the clarity in his mind as to who emperumAn was and wondered at the sight \u201chow beautiful is this!\u201d (this itself became the reason for SiSupAlan to attain liberation from materialistic realm and reach SrIvaikuNtam as he was able to envision <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/sriman-narayanan\/\">emperumAn<\/a> is his final moments).<\/p>\n<p><strong>nediyOy<\/strong> \u2013 <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/poigai-azhwar\/\">AzhwAr<\/a> wonders whether it is possible to estimate the greatness of emperumAn going by his affection towards those who had a little bit of affection towards him.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Iraindhu mudiyAn padaiththa muraN nediyOy adi adaidhaRku anRE<\/strong> \u2013 <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\/index.php\/poigai-azhwar\/\">AzhwAr<\/a> says \u201cwasn\u2019t it due to the devotion that rAvaNan had towards you (later as SiSupAlan) which made him attain your divine feet? Wasn\u2019t it due to your mercy that he attained you? What prevents you from showering that affection towards me? Is my fault worse than his enmity? When you had treated his enmity as real affection, is there any barrier for you to consider my falsified affection as real affection towards you?\u201d<\/p>\n<p>We shall take up the 36<sup>th<\/sup> pAsuram next.<\/p>\n<p>adiyEn krishNa ramanuja dhAsan<\/p>\n<p>archived in <a href=\"https:\/\/divyaprabandham.koyil.org\">https:\/\/divyaprabandham.koyil.org<\/a><\/p>\n<p>pramEyam (goal) \u2013 <a href=\"https:\/\/koyil.org\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ener noreferrer\">https:\/\/koyil.org<\/a><br \/>\npramANam (scriptures) \u2013 <a href=\"http:\/\/granthams.koyil.org\">http:\/\/granthams.koyil.org<\/a><br \/>\npramAthA (preceptors) \u2013 <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\">http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org<\/a><br \/>\nSrIvaishNava education\/kids portal \u2013 <a href=\"https:\/\/pillai.koyil.org\/\">http:\/\/pillai.koyil.org<\/a><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>SrI:\u00a0 SrImathE SatakOpAya nama:\u00a0 SrImathE rAmAnujAya nama:\u00a0 SrImath varavaramunayE nama: Full Series &lt;&lt; Previous avathArikai AzhwAr knows that compared to the love showered by yaSOdhAp pirAtti on emperumAn, the love shown by people such as he himself would be equivalent to being inimical to him.
